    Abstract: A method for producing a high-strength steel sheet having high ductility, formability and weldability includes providing a cold-rolled sheet, with a composition containing: 0.15% ?C?0.23%, 1.4% ?Mn?2.6%, 0.6% ?Si?1.3%, with C+Si/10?0.30%, 0.4% ?Al?1.0%, with Al?6(C+Mn/10)?2.5%, 0.010% ?Nb?0.035%, 0.1% ?Mo?0.5%, annealing the sheet at 860° C.-900° C. to obtain a structure consisting of at least 90% austenite and at least 2% intercritical ferrite, quenching to a temperature between Ms-10° C. and Ms-60° C. at a rate Vc higher than 30° C./s, heating to a temperature PT between 410° C. and 470° C. for 60 s to 130 s, hot-dip coating the sheet, and cooling to room temperature. The microstructure includes 45% to 68% of martensite, consisting of 85% to 95% partitioned martensite having a C content of at most 0.45%, and fresh martensite; 10% to 15% retained austenite; 2% to 10% intercritical ferrite; 20% to 30% lower bainite.

    Abstract: A method of continuous manufacturing of solidified steelmaking slag including the steps of solidifying molten steelmaking slag comprising at least 2% in weight of free lime so as to produce solidified slag particles having a diameter below 1 mm, the molten steelmaking slag being put in contact with at least a first carbonation gas during such solidification, cooling the solidified slag particles down to a temperature below or equal to 300° C., in a closed chamber, the solidified slag particles being put in contact with at least one second carbonation gas during such cooling. The invention is also related to an associated device.

    Abstract: A method is for manufacturing a high-strength steel sheet having a tensile strength of more than 1100 MPa and a yield strength of more than 700 MPa, a uniform elongation UE of at least 8.0% and a total elongation of at least 10%, made of a steel containing in percent by weight: 0.1%?C?0.25%, 4.5%?Mn?10%, 1%?Si?3%, 0.03%?Al?2.5%, the remainder being Fe and impurities resulting from the smelting, the composition being such that CMnIndex=C×(1+Mn/3.5)?0.6. The method includes annealing a rolled sheet made of said steel by soaking it at an annealing temperature TA higher than the Ac1 transformation point of the steel but less than 1000° C., cooling the annealed sheet to a quenching temperature QT between 190° C. and 80° C. at a cooling speed sufficient to obtain a structure just after cooling containing martensite and retained austenite, maintaining the steel sheet at an overaging temperature PT between 350° C. and 500° C. for an overaging time Pt of more than 5 s cooling the sheet down to the ambient temperature.

    Abstract: A method for producing a zinc or zinc-alloy coated steel sheet with a tensile strength higher than 900 MPa, for the fabrication of resistance spot welds containing in average not more than two Liquid Metal Embrittlement cracks per weld having a depth of 100 ?m or more, with steps of providing a cold-rolled steel sheet, heating cold-rolled steel sheet up to a temperature T1 between 550° C. and Ac1+50° C. in a furnace zone with an atmosphere (A1) containing from 2 to 15% hydrogen by volume, so that the iron is not oxidized, then adding in the furnace atmosphere, water steam or oxygen with an injection flow rate Q higher than (0.07%/h×?), ? being equal to 1 if said element is water steam or equal to 0.52 if said element is oxygen, at a temperature T?T1, so to obtain an atmosphere (A2) with a dew point DP2 between ?15° C. and the temperature Te of the iron/iron oxide equilibrium dew point, then heating the sheet from temperature T1 up to a temperature T2 between 720° C. and 1000° C.

    Abstract: A method for producing a high strength steel sheet having a yield strength YS of at least 850 MPa, a tensile strength TS of at least 1180 MPa, a total elongation of at least 14% and a hole expansion ratio HER of at least 30%. The chemical composition of the steel contains: 0.15%?C?0.25%, 1.2%?Si?1.8%, 2%?Mn?2.4%, 0.1%?Cr?0.25%, Nb?0.05%, Ti?0.05%, Al?0.50%, the remainder being Fe and unavoidable impurities. The sheet is annealed at an annealing temperature TA higher than Ac3 but less than 1000° C. for more than 30 s, by cooling it to a quenching temperature QT between 275° C. and 325° C., at a cooling speed sufficient to have, just after quenching, a structure consisting of austenite and at least 50% of martensite, the austenite content en.) being such that the final structure can contain between 3% and 15% of residual austenite and between 85 and 97% of the sum of martensite and bainite, without ferrite, heated to a partitioning temperature PT between 420° C. and 470° C.
